Maintaining Your 2019 Toyota Mark X's Coolant System

The coolant system of your 2019 Toyota Mark X is integral to ensuring your engine's long-term health and performance. Coolant, also known as antifreeze, is responsible for maintaining the engine's temperature by dissipating heat and protecting the metal components from rust and corrosion. Let's delve into how to take care of this crucial aspect of your vehicle.

Coolant replacement and regular checks should be an essential part of your vehicle's routine maintenance. Here's a guide on how often you should do this and why it's important:

  1. Regular Inspection: Regularly check the coolant level in the reservoir. This should ideally be done every month. Make sure the coolant reaches the "Full" mark when the engine is cold. If you find yourself frequently topping it up, there might be a leak or an issue with the coolant system.
  2. Replacement Intervals: The general recommendation for coolant replacement is every 4 to 5 years or every 100,000 to 150,000 kilometres. However, you should always refer to the vehicle's owner's manual for model-specific advice. Regular replacement helps ensure the coolant's effectiveness in temperature regulation and prevents rust and scaling within the cooling system.
  3. Understand Coolant Types: Your 2019 Toyota Mark X likely utilises long-life or super long-life coolant, which has specific properties and formulations. Using the right type is essential to maintain the integrity of your vehicle's cooling system.
  4. Check for Contamination: Coolant should be free of debris and maintain a vibrant colour, usually green, pink, or blue, depending on the type. If the coolant appears discoloured or has particles floating in it, a system flush is likely necessary.
  5. Consider Professional Inspection: Have a professional check the coolant's pH level and freezing/boiling points during regular servicing. A coolant that falls outside optimum specifications can lead to overheating or freeze damage.

By ensuring the coolant system is in top condition, you'll prevent potential problems such as overheating, engine knocks, or gasket failures. A well-maintained system will also help maintain fuel efficiency and extend the overall lifespan of your vehicle.
